Canon Marketing Japan Inc. is involved in the sale of Canon-branded products and the provision of marketing and other services in Japan, as well as the information technology (IT) solutions, industrial equipment and healthcare businesses. The Company operates in four segments. The Consumer segment provides digital cameras and inkjet printers to individual customers. The Enterprise segment provides input and output devices and solutions that contribute to solving business problems for large companies. The Area segment provides input and output devices and solutions that help customers solve business problems for small and medium-sized businesses. The Professional segment provides solutions for customers in each area.

The Canon Marketing Japan Inc PE ratio based on its reported earnings over the past 12 months is 14.16. The shares are currently trading at ¥2556.
The PE ratio (or price-to-earnings ratio) is the one of the most popular valuation measures used by stock market investors. It is calculated by dividing a company's price per share by its earnings per share.
The PE ratio can be seen as being expressed in years, in the sense that it shows the number of years of earnings which would be required to pay back the purchase price, ignoring inflation. So in general terms, the higher the PE, the more expensive the stock is.
